⢠Basic Cryogenics: Introduction to the principles and applications of cryogenics, including the behavior of materials at low temperatures.
⢠Biological Sample Preservation: Techniques for preserving biological samples using cryogenic methods, including the use of liquid nitrogen.
⢠Bio-Cryogenic Equipment and Instrumentation: Overview of the equipment and instrumentation used in bio-cryogenics, including cryostats, dilution refrigerators, and magnetic susceptometers.
⢠Cryobiology: The study of the effects of low temperatures on biological systems, including the mechanisms of freeze damage and the principles of cryopreservation.
⢠Cryopreservation Protocols: Detailed instruction on various cryopreservation protocols for different types of biological samples, such as cells, tissues, and organs.
⢠Vitrification: Advanced cryopreservation technique that involves cooling samples to temperatures below the glass transition point, preventing the formation of ice crystals.
⢠Cryogenic Storage and Transport: Procedures for the safe and effective storage and transport of cryogenically preserved biological samples.
⢠Bio-Cryogenic Safety: Best practices for working safely in a bio-cryogenic laboratory, including the handling and disposal of cryogenic liquids and the use of personal protective equipment.
⢠Research Applications of Bio-Cryogenics: Exploration of the latest research applications of bio-cryogenics, including its use in the fields of regenerative medicine, stem cell research, and cryo-electron microscopy.
